     Robin Saville and Antony Ryan, two English gentlemen who
     create music together under the nom de plume Isan, return with
     their sixth full length album for their spiritual home of Morr
     Music. ItÆs been a few years since IsanÆs previous outing, the
     delectable electronic esoterica of Plans Drawn In Pencil, but
     our heroes havenÆt been lazy. ôWe played some lovely shows on
     the back of the album and then took an unintentional
     sabbatical,ö explains Robin. ôAntony moved to Denmark and then
     Sweden where he's now learning to be a glass blower. No
     reallyö, he deadpans in as good natured a way one close friend
     can talk about another. Robin also released a critically
     acclaimed album himself, the agrarian electronica of Peasgood
     Nonsuch. No wonder it took them a while to finish Glow In The
     Dark Safari Set. The results, in (ahem) time-honoured Isan
     tradition, are certainly worth the wait. Opener, Channel Ten,
     with its Autobahn-assured poise, appropriately prefigures a
     body of work that is IsanÆs finest to date. Inspiration for
     this came from æemancipationÆ as Robin elaborates ôIt was an
     attempt to jettison the weight of our back catalogue and get
     back to the fun of making music. This entailed playing with
     ancient Casios, mangled tape loops and squidgy noises. Very
     hands-on. Most of the tracks on the album started life away
     from the laptopö This giddy sense of enjoyment suffuses the
     album û from the glistening rush of Merman Sound which segues
     into the soft focus sound world of its own coda seamlessly to
     the cinematic, techy strut of Grissette or the calmly
     oscillating and cascading melodies of Greencracked which evoke
     images of a retro-futurist utopia. Isan have always excelled
     at fashioning a quietly awe-inspiring music and Glow... is no
     exception. Even the title suggests a sense of wide-eyed-wonder
     ôWe were playing with lots of ideas around fire, embers,
     bioluminescence and the title popped into my head one day. It
     seemed to sum up a lot of the things we like - I like to
     imagine sitting in a darkened room looking at the gentle green
     glow of 1970s vu meters, then they all come to life and start
     crawling up the wallö says Antony. Such is the albumÆs
     celestial hot-wired circuit board wizardry; Glow In The Dark
     Safari Set positively throbs, ebbs and flows with
     electronically refracted ideas and melodies û a digital tone
     poem sitting somewhere betwixt the cosy experimentation of the
     BBC Radiophonic Workshop and the exotic sonic emissions of a
     top secret Dⁿsseldorf studio circa 1975. ôI think we'd like to
     see it as a bit of a reset in terms of the Isan canonö
     concludes Robin. If thatÆs the case then Isan fans old and new
     will be delighted to hear that Glow In The Dark Safari Set
     points to a beautiful future. Bask in its brilliance. - Rich
     Hanscomb
